Obituary of William (Bill) Alfred Morris

It is with deep sadness that we announce the passing of William (Bill) Alfred Morris, who died peacefully at Markham Stouffville Hospital on January 11, at the age of 95. Bill was a longtime resident of Wyndham Gardens and will be fondly remembered for his warmth, integrity, and enduring spirit.

Bill spent many years working in sales in the fastener industry, where he was known for his dedication and strong work ethic. Beyond his career, his greatest passions—next to his family—were skiing and his faith. An avid and competitive skier well into later life, Bill embraced the sport with enthusiasm and determination. He was also a man of deep faith and remained actively involved with his church for many years.

Bill was devotedly married to his beloved wife, Elaine, for 68 years, and is lovingly survived by her. He is also survived by his son, Brian (Pam Capaldi), and his daughter, Carol-Ann (Paul Freeman). Bill was a proud and loving grandfather to Sarah, Thomas, Michael, and Claire.

For those who wish, donations can be made to the Alzheimer's Society.
